Understanding Business Phone Systems

What Are Business Phone Systems?

At their core, business phone systems are advanced communication networks specifically designed for handling the complex needs of businesses, ranging from customer service calls to internal communications. Unlike traditional phone systems, which typically serve basic calling functions, business phone systems come with a suite of features that support multitasking and collaboration across various platforms.

Evolution with Technology

The evolution of business phone systems mirrors the rapid advancement in technology. From the early days of manual switchboards to the latest in VoIP (Voice over Internet Protocol) and cloud-based solutions, these systems have transformed to offer more flexibility, reliability, and efficiency. Types of Business Phone Systems

Traditional Landline Systems

Traditionally, businesses relied on landline systems, operated and maintained by local or regional phone companies. These systems use copper wiring to transmit voice data, which, while reliable, lack the flexibility and advanced features modern businesses require.

VoIP Systems

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) systems represent a leap forward, transmitting voice as data over the internet. This type allows for greater flexibility, lower costs, and a host of advanced features not possible with traditional landlines. VoIP systems are ideal for businesses with a good internet connection looking to leverage modern communication features.

Virtual Phone Systems

Virtual phone systems operate as a middleman between a traditional phone system and the user’s mobile device, offering a way to manage calls without needing physical phone lines. These systems are perfect for remote teams or small businesses needing professional calling features without the infrastructure of a full phone system.

Hybrid Systems

Hybrid systems combine the reliability of traditional landlines with the flexibility of VoIP technology, offering businesses a transitional solution. They are an excellent choice for organizations not ready to fully commit to internet-based systems but wanting to start integrating modern features into their communication strategies.

Comparison and How to Choose

Choosing the right type involves assessing your business’s size, needs, budget, and future growth projections. Consider factors like the reliability of your internet connection, the importance of mobility and remote work capabilities, and the need for advanced features.

Features of Modern Business Phone Systems

Modern business phone systems boast an array of features designed to enhance operational efficiency and customer service. Understanding these features is crucial for businesses looking to leverage technology to its fullest.

Advanced Call Management

This encompasses call routing, hold music, and automated attendants, ensuring that customer calls are handled professionally and efficiently, improving the overall customer experience.

Voicemail to Email Transcription

Voicemail to email transcription sends voicemails as text to your email, allowing for quicker response times and documentation of customer interactions.

Call Forwarding and Queuing

These features ensure that no call goes unanswered, allowing businesses to manage high call volumes effectively and route calls to the appropriate department or individual.

Interactive Voice Response (IVR)

IVR systems guide callers through a series of automated menus and options, helping direct them to the correct department or information, reducing wait times and improving service efficiency.

Integration Capabilities

The ability to integrate with CRM systems and other business software is a game-changer, allowing for seamless communication and information sharing across platforms.

Benefits of Upgrading to a Modern System

Cost Savings

Modern phone systems, especially those based on VoIP technology, can significantly reduce communication costs. By leveraging the internet for calls, businesses can avoid the high fees associated with traditional landline services, especially for long-distance and international calls. Additionally, the maintenance and hardware costs are considerably lower, as modern systems often require less physical infrastructure.

Improved Communication Efficiency

With features like advanced call management, mobile integration, and voicemail to email transcription, modern phone systems make communication more efficient. Employees can manage calls more effectively, ensuring that important calls are never missed and that customer queries are handled promptly.

Flexibility and Scalability

The adaptability of modern phone systems to business growth is one of their standout benefits. Whether you’re adding new employees or expanding to new locations, these systems can scale to meet your changing needs without significant infrastructure changes. Moreover, the flexibility to integrate with various business tools and software enhances operational fluidity.

Enhanced Customer Experience

Features such as IVR, call queuing, and direct extensions can significantly enhance the customer experience. They reduce wait times, direct callers to the right department or individual quickly, and personalize the customer’s journey, contributing to higher satisfaction and loyalty.

Choosing the Right Business Phone System for Your Company

Assessing Business Needs

Understanding your specific business needs is the first step in selecting the right phone system. Consider factors like the size of your workforce, the volume of calls you handle, and any specific features you require, such as mobile integration or CRM compatibility.

Considering Scalability

Opt for a system that can grow with your business. Assess the scalability options of each system to ensure that as your business expands, your communication tools can adapt seamlessly.

Evaluating Features vs. Cost

While modern phone systems offer a plethora of features, it’s essential to balance these against the costs. Determine which features are must-haves versus nice-to-haves and consider the total cost of ownership, including setup, maintenance, and upgrade expenses.
